Autumn Sits on the Corner
The rains have returned,
After summer holiday
Of grasses brown burned,
Reservoirs almost empty,
And dusty long days.
The nights begin cooling down
As green spreads across the ground.
Trees drink the sky tears
As warm play ends for children,
Hair cuts and clean ears
They return to class again
To harvest learning
From ancient books and teachers
As the year turns in colors.
Skies are softer grays,
Crystal blue and clouds fluff white,
Skies of shorter days
That rush quicker into night
Over color change
Trees tinge with yellow and red
Preparing colorful shed.
The rains have returned,
As warm play ends for children,
Skies of shorter days
